Russian President Vladimir Putin and Iranian President Masoud Pezeshkian shake hands as they meet in Moscow, Russia January 17, 2025. REUTERS/Evgenia Novozhenina/Pool
Russian President Vladimir Putin and Iranian President Masoud Pezeshkian shake hands as they meet in Moscow, Russia January 17, 2025. REUTERS/Evgenia Novozhenina/Pool